In an exciting announcement, Nintendo has introduced My Mario, a new range of products designed specifically for young children. This innovative line includes amiibo building blocks that allow kids to engage in creative play while exploring the beloved Mario universe. The products aim to inspire imagination and provide an interactive experience for the youngest fans of the franchise.
Currently, the My Mario line is set to launch exclusively in Japan, generating buzz among parents and children alike. However, Nintendo has confirmed that select items from the collection will be available internationally next year, expanding the reach of this delightful product line.
The amiibo building blocks are designed to be both fun and educational, encouraging children to develop their fine motor skills while enjoying the colorful and engaging world of Mario. As anticipation builds for the international release, fans are eager to see how these products will enhance playtime and introduce a new generation to the joy of Nintendo's iconic characters.
